Abstract

A clutch for a manual or automatic transmission according to the present invention includes an axial fan or turbine disposed on a shaft extending between the clutch and the transmission. Air is supplied to the turbine through one or more radial passageways between the clutch and transmission housings and is provided through an annular passageway around the shaft. Air from the annular passageway is then dispersed generally radially between the clutch plates or disks and other clutch components to absorb and carry away heat generated during clutch operation.
